JOB TITLE: Lead Infrastructure Specialist (Telephony Platform)

SALARY: £90,440 - £106,400

LOCATION(S): Leeds, Manchester or Edinburgh

HOURS: Full time

WORKING PATTERN: Our work style is hybrid, which involves spending at least two days per week, or 40% of our time, at our locations. This role includes participation in a 24/7 on-call support schedule.

About this Opportunity

Join Network Services at a pivotal time of transformation, where innovation, collaboration, and personal growth are at the heart of everything we do.

We’re looking for a Lead Infrastructure Specialist to head up the front and back office telephony platform, part of the Core Infrastructure Platform. This is a senior technical role with strategic responsibility including a large-scale enterprise telephony platform—a critical component of the Group’s infrastructure and future direction.

You’ll help shape and deliver network services that are resilient, secure, and future-ready, while supporting the Group’s broader mission, including its commitment to sustainability and technology modernisation.

As the Lead Infrastructure Specialist  for our Telephony Platform, you will:

  • Lead a team of Telephony Specialists, providing technical direction, mentoring, and fostering a culture of continuous improvement.

  • Design, develop, and integrate enterprise-grade voice solutions, ensuring they are scalable, resilient, and aligned with strategic goals.

  • Drive automation and orchestration across voice network processes to improve efficiency, accuracy, and agility.

  • Identify and implement opportunities to reduce operating and change costs, enhance delivery precision, and adopt innovative approaches to service and change management.

  • Act as a technical authority, bringing confidence and clarity to complex voice solution decisions, ensuring alignment with industry best practices and Group technology policies.

  • Ensure people, processes, and platforms are prepared for the future, contributing to the transformation of Networks through DevOps, Agile practices, and enhanced technical capabilities.

What you’ll need

  • Extensive experience large scale telephony platforms and voice solutions, with exposure to technologies such as Avaya, Genesys, Verint, and RingCentral.

  • Proven ability to lead engineering teams, manage risk, and balance service protection with transformation.

  • Strong background in automation and Infrastructure as Code (IaC), with proficiency in tools such as Python, Jenkins, Harness, Ansible, Terraform, Docker.

  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ills, with the ability to influence and engage across technical and business stakeholders.

  • Experience in roadmap creation, managing technical debt, maintaining production health, and developing team capabilities aligned to future architecture.

  • A proactive mindset for unblocking technical challenges, exploring new patterns, and proving solutions ready for enterprise adoption.
